NP3500SAT3G Equivalent & Substitute Parts

Part Overview

The NP3500SAT3G is a 320V off-state thyristor-based transient voltage suppressor (TVS) in DO-214AA surface mount packaging, manufactured by onsemi. This component is designed for transient overvoltage protection applications requiring 50A peak pulse current capability. The part is currently obsolete, making identification of suitable substitute components necessary for ongoing design support and production continuity.

Substitute Part Grouping Explanation

Substitution eligibility for TVS thyristor components is determined by the following critical parameters:

  • Voltage Rating Match: Breakover voltage (400V) and off-state voltage (320V) must be identical to ensure proper transient suppression without nuisance triggering
  • On-State Voltage: Must remain at 4V to maintain circuit protection characteristics
  • Hold Current (Ih): Must match at 150mA for stable device operation
  • Package Compatibility: DO-214AA, SMB surface mount package required for PCB layout compatibility
  • Element Configuration: Single-element design must be preserved
  • Mounting Type: Surface mount requirement must be maintained

The P3500SALRP meets all critical substitution criteria across voltage ratings, hold current, package type, and mounting configuration.

Engineering Selection Recommendations

The P3500SALRP (Littelfuse SIDACtor®) is a direct functional substitute for the obsolete NP3500SAT3G. Both components share identical voltage ratings (400V breakover, 320V off-state), on-state voltage (4V), and hold current (150mA), with matching DO-214AA surface mount packaging and MSL rating.

The P3500SALRP offers the advantage of active product status with ROHS3 compliance certification, ensuring long-term availability and regulatory alignment. The peak pulse current specification differs slightly (45A at 10/1000µs versus 50A), and capacitance is marginally higher (35pF versus 28pF), but these variations remain within acceptable operating parameters for TVS thyristor applications.

Frequently Asked Questions (FAQ)

Q: Can the P3500SALRP directly replace the NP3500SAT3G in existing designs?

A: Yes. Both components share identical voltage ratings, on-state voltage, hold current, and DO-214AA packaging. The P3500SALRP is functionally equivalent for transient suppression applications.

Q: What is the significance of the peak pulse current difference (50A vs. 45A)?

A: The NP3500SAT3G is rated for 50A peak pulse at 10/1000µs, while the P3500SALRP is rated for 45A at the same pulse width. This difference reflects manufacturer test conditions and does not preclude substitution in applications designed for the original 50A specification, provided circuit transient energy remains within acceptable limits.

Q: Does the capacitance difference (28pF vs. 35pF) affect circuit performance?

A: The capacitance increase from 28pF to 35pF is minor and typically does not impact circuit performance in standard TVS applications. Verification may be necessary in high-frequency or sensitive timing-critical circuits.

Q: Is the P3500SALRP available in the same packaging format?

A: Yes. Both components use DO-214AA, SMB surface mount packaging, ensuring identical PCB footprint and assembly compatibility.

Q: What is the product status difference, and why does it matter?

A: The NP3500SAT3G is obsolete, meaning onsemi no longer manufactures or supports this component. The P3500SALRP is active, ensuring continued availability, technical support, and compliance with current regulatory standards including ROHS3.
